The disposal of used tires, the main source of waste rubber, is an important environmental problem. We describe a method to transform used rubber tires into useful liquid products by coprocessing them with coal. Carbon black, an important constituent in rubber tires, provides a good hydrocracking catalyst during coprocessing. Due to the presence of carbon black in the rubber tires, the yields of liquids obtained by coal-rubber tires coprocessing are superior to those that could be obtained by coprocessing rubber with coal in the absence of carbon black.
